German Wirehaired Pointer vs Slovak Rough-haired Pointer: full comparison

TraitGerman Wirehaired PointerSlovak Rough-haired Pointer
SizeLargeLarge
Energy levelVery HighVery High
TrainabilityHighHigh
FriendlinessMediumMedium
Good with childrenHighHigh
Grooming needsMediumMedium
SheddingLowMedium
BarkingMediumMedium
ProtectivenessMediumMedium
AdaptabilityMediumMedium
Typical lifespan12 years12 years
HypoallergenicNoNo

Frequently asked questions

Is the German Wirehaired Pointer or the Slovak Rough-haired Pointer better for families with children?
Both the German Wirehaired Pointer and the Slovak Rough-haired Pointer are considered good with children when properly socialised and supervised.
Which sheds more, the German Wirehaired Pointer or the Slovak Rough-haired Pointer?
The Slovak Rough-haired Pointer sheds more than the German Wirehaired Pointer. If shedding is a concern, the German Wirehaired Pointer is the lower-maintenance choice.
Which is easier to train, the German Wirehaired Pointer or the Slovak Rough-haired Pointer?
Both breeds have comparable trainability. Consistency and positive reinforcement work well for each.
